笔者本科211GIS专业出身,从事GIS开发近三年时间,对国内的GIS行业和就业的情势也窥得一角。本文根据笔者自身经验和周边朋友的经验总结而出。希望这篇文章可以对GIS专业的学生和打算从事GIS行业的读者可以有一点点参考价值。
涉及行业、公司
在这里笔者给gis相关的行业公司做出两个分类:弱GIS行业/公司和强GIS行业/公司。弱GIS是指 GIS模块在该行业/公司的项目和产品中并非核心,往往是为了更直观的呈现项目和产品的数据,而强GIS公司/行业是指GIS在项目或产品中为核心,产品的需求,系统的架构都是以GIS为主导,或者说GIS在其中有着极其重要的比重。
举例说明下,如亚信、亿阳、浪潮、泰岳这家公司都是通信行业的服务供应商,在对比如基站设备等等进行选址、建站、管理,对于移动用户的位置信息分析等等相关的一些需求中,需要借助GIS直观可视化的表达,或者是借助GIS进行一些分析。但是这些需求占实际的整体需求的比重不多。所以一般弱GIS行业/公司的GIS开发人员配比较少,常见的都是一个团队需要一到两个GIS开发人员即可。强GIS行业/公司诸如超图、吉奥,通常会以GIS为核心为国土,政务,环境等行业提供GIS数据存储,应用,分析等等诸多强GIS相关业务的开发定制。后面在就业中再详细说说去两种类型的地方工作的区别。
就业现状
笔者目前了解到的情况来看,目前GIS行业有个挺奇怪的现象。本科GIS毕业的想去做GIS开发但是没有相关的开发能力,硕士GIS毕业的有GIS开发能力但是并不愿意去做GIS开发。且不论这个现象是否可以覆盖到整个GIS圈子。有一点可以确认的是,GIS开发的市场目前是远远未达到饱和。大体上原因就是GIS专业毕业的实际去从事GIS开发的比例很少,而CS专业的去研究GIS开发的也很少。事实上CS专业的从事GIS开发会比我们GIS专业的跟容易上手,但是缺少GIS专业知识的他们在一些复杂的业务场景或者一些专业化的业务需求上很难借助到GIS的知识去解决。而由于除了一些比较重视GIS开发的高校会在本科阶段教授一些GIS开发的内容,大部分GIS专业的学生都是在硕士阶段才开始接触。(尽管大学有开设C语言,数据库,C#开发等等课程,但是实际效果我相信懂得都懂)。
再说说目前GIS开发就业的方向,目前无外乎就是WEBGIS开发 和传统的C/S GIS开发。那毋庸置疑的,现阶段webgis开发肯定是有打算从事GIS开发的不二之选,这个原因就不细谈了。
那接下来就是诸位关系的薪资待遇的问题了。以北京来说,有初级GIS开发水平的,薪资大概在8k-10k左右浮动,中级大概在12k-18k左右浮动,高级的就20k+了。那武汉,成都,南京这些城市大概是上述的80%左右。当然了前面在分类中说过有强GIS行业和弱GIS行业,那一般来说弱GIS行业的从事GIS开发的薪资要比强GIS行业的要高。这里简单说下原因,因为在弱GIS行业,GIS开发人员占比少,而gis相关的活基本全部落在仅有的几个人上,甚至包括GIS数据处理,服务发布等等。而强GIS公司由于GIS开发的占比多,包括实施,测试都会有一些GIS背景,GIS开发的工作量相对来说要低一点。
发展趋势
笔者这里在发表一下对GIS开发以后发展的拙见,以后GIS开发主要是二三维一体化为主要架构,更侧重在大数据方向的应用,这里包括时空大数据的分析挖掘,人工智能在GIS数据分析、处理、决策上的应用。在二三维的大数据可视化,在三维的场景可视化(BIM、倾斜摄影测量、精模)以及浏览器端的分析处理都是以后的可以预见的火热方向。此外多源空间数据的融合,存储,关联;用户自定义空间分析编排等等也是大热的GIS开发方向。
总结一下,如今的GIS开发绝不是仅仅依靠一些GIS库做一做可视化相关的工作,而是真正的加入了数据时代的浪潮。作为一名GISer,笔者希望有更多的人可以投入到这个未来可期的方向,这样这个生态圈才会更加繁荣!
上述言论都是笔者个人浅见,仅供读者参考,欢迎各位交流,如有批评指正请留言
下篇预告 WEBGIS开发技能图谱